Menu
Your Cart

WHELEN 71156 LED FLASHER ASSEMBLY - 28V 01-0771156-04

WHELEN 71156 LED FLASHER ASSEMBLY - 28V 01-0771156-04
Longer fulfillment
WHELEN 71156 LED FLASHER ASSEMBLY - 28V 01-0771156-04
WHELEN 71156 LED FLASHER ASSEMBLY - 28V 01-0771156-04

Write a review

Note: HTML is not translated!
Bad Good
Captcha
  • Manufacturer Part #: 01-0771156-04
$888.00